Miss Indiana State Fair 2016 to visit Cass County

Last Updated on July 6, 2016 by cassnetwork

statefairqueen_2016_portraitMiss Indiana State Fair 2016, Tate Fritchley will be a guest at the Cass County 4-H Fair Queen Pageant Workshop tonight to do a Q&A with contestants, as well as help with modeling, on stage questions, and a mock interview. Tate Fritchley is the 58th Miss Indiana State Fair, crowned in January, and a native of Vanderburgh County. Fritchley is a 10-year 4-H member of the Horse and Pony Club and recent graduate of Evansville North High School with plans to attend Butler University next fall. Fritchley will head across Indiana to visit over 45 county fairs, festivals and queen pageants this summer helping to share in fairgoers excitement about the 2016 Indiana State Fair which will Celebrate Indiana’s Bicentennial, August 5-21.
